Before choosing a car insurance company do some research.
To get the cheapest possible rate make sure you call few companies
before you decide which insurance company you will join. Make a
list of all questions you might have before you call and be ready
to answer questions you will be asked. A lot of car insurance companies
will try and sell you additional products, which you might not need,
make sure you fully understand what these optional features are.
If not sure ASK, remember, it's your job to ask questions and their
job to answer them. If you are asked a question and you are not
sure if you have to answer it ASK. Be sure to visit companies listed

Here are examples of questions that you might be asked when getting
your online quote:
- your name
- your full address
- how long at the residence
- number of claims in last 3 years
- number of accidents in last 3 years (at fault or not)
- number of convictions
- does the driver have 5 or more years of driving experience
- has the driver been found by a court to have committed automobile
insurance fraud
- Will the car be rented or leased to others, or used to carry passengers
or goods for compensation or hire, or haul a trailer, or carry explosives
or radioactive material
- have you been refused to insure or your policy been cancelled
in the last 3 years
- has your driver's licence been suspended or cancelled in the last
5 years
- What make is your car, year, model, approximate value and mileage
- your current driver's license class
- your occupational status
- your employment status |
